About the role
- Support the company’s taxable income and effective tax rate projection process, including managing data requests from groups outside tax and coordinating the required inputs and support from Tax Operations and Tax Strategy.
- Assist with scenario analyses related to taxable income and/or effective tax rate projections, preparing clear and accurate analytical support for review by senior team members.
- Partner with FP&A to understand pre-tax financial projections and help translate that information into tax-relevant inputs.
- Support quarterly tax provision processes including:
- Interim period tax provision calculations
- Valuation allowance support
- Tax accounting considerations related to third-party and intercompany transactions
- Support quarterly documentation of tax and accounting treatment for intercompany transactions, partnering with Tax Operations and Tax Strategy and reflecting impacts in taxable income and ETR projections.
- Contribute to competitor and peer analysis projects by gathering data, performing analysis, and summarizing findings.
- Support the maintenance of U.S. earnings and profits (E&P) balances and subsidiary tax basis calculations for U.S. and non U.S. entities.
- Prepare workpapers, analyses, and memoranda that are incorporated into the broader tax provision and planning process.
- Collaborate effectively with colleagues across Tax Operations, Tax Strategy, FP&A, and other internal stakeholders.
Requirements
- Bachelor’s degree in Accounting, Finance, or a related field required.
- CPA, CMA, or other relevant certifications preferred but not required.
- Advanced degree (e.g., MBA, Master’s in Taxation) a plus.
- 4-6 years of tax experience in a corporate tax department or public accounting firm.
- Insurance tax experience and familiarity with tax issues for multinational financial institutions is required.
- Proven experience in supporting tax compliance, tax provision, and tax planning functions.
- Must be a self-starter, strong analytical and problem-solving skills with attention to detail.
- Proficiency in tax software and financial systems.
- Must have strong issue identification skills.
- Strong organizational and planning skills, with demonstrated ability to work efficiently and with integrity.
- Ability to manage multiple deliverables and deadlines with appropriate guidance.
- Demonstrated follow-through, organization and accountability.
- Attention to detail, proactive, flexibility/adaptability, and enthusiastic.
- Strong work ethic, listening skills, and openness to feedback and learning.
- Excellent written and verbal communication skills, with the ability to articulate complex tax issues to the Head of Tax and senior tax professionals.
- Collaborative mindset and ability to work effectively across Fortitude’s tax teams, internal partners, and external advisors.
